Treat Yo’Self is such an adorable set and I fell in love with the cotton candy image. I didn’t want to just use that one image and that’s how I ended up with three different cards. 

I stamped everything out using Versafine Onyx Black ink so I could heat emboss them using clear embossing powder. I wanted to do some watercoloring since these images are really spacious. By having the images heat embossed, it helps me contain the colors within its respective areas. 

After I finished watercoloring all the images (which I did in rainbow colors), I decided to ink blend a rainbow background as well. I used this one A2 panel to help create three cards. I trimmed it down to two strips of 1.75 in x 5.50 and then two strips of .25 x 5.50 inches. 

CARD 1: 

I placed my first rainbows trip horizontally on the card adding the matching popsicles colors along the rainbow. For the sentiment, I stamped it using Blackout ink on the bottom right of the rainbow panel. 

CARD 2: 

For my second card, I wanted to add the rainbow strip vertically on the left hand side. This time, I’m using the ice cream cones and placing them in opposite rainbow order. Since I had white space on the right, I added a sentiment in the bottom right hand corner. I trimmed down my card panel a quarter of a inch and added a piece of striped black and white washi for a bit of interest so my first two cards didn’t look exactly the same. 

CARD 3: 

I added a piece black cardstock and heat embossed the sentiment in white. Since I had two strips of the rainbow panel left, I added it to the top and bottom of the black cardstock. I grouped three of the cotton candy cones together in opposing corners to finish off the card.
